Guys, i will have to change tyre for my Nissan Sentra soon. Now using Pirelli tyre. Think of changing to Michelin.

Any better alternatives ? Preferable to have low noise from the tyre

p/s i know nothing about car tyres

Michelin XM is pretty good, quiet and comfortable. Had them on my Toyota Wish for awhile. I'm now on other Michelins for my other cars too and prefer Michelins in general over the others I've tried (Bridgestone, Continental, Falkens).
